AMN Healthcare currently has 2 Acute Care Physical Therapy jobs available in Red Lodge, with start dates as early as 7/13/26. As of July 10, 2026, the average weekly pay for a Acute Care Physical Therapist in Red Lodge was $2,404, with the range in pay between $2,366 and $2,442.

Request StaffingFor an Acute Care Physical Therapy travel job in Red Lodge, Montana, candidates typically need a valid physical therapist license and previous experience in an acute care setting, such as a hospital or rehabilitation facility. Additional preferences may include specialty certifications and familiarity with the local healthcare protocols.
Acute Care Physical Therapy travel jobs in Red Lodge, Montana, are typically found in hospitals and medical centers that provide immediate treatment for serious injuries and illnesses. These facilities often require therapists to work closely with patients recovering from surgery, trauma, or other acute medical conditions.
For Acute Care Physical Therapy Travel jobs in Red Lodge, MT, typical contract durations range from 14-26 weeks. These flexible contract lengths allow you to choose an assignment that best fits your career goals and lifestyle preferences.
An Acute Care Physical Therapist seeking a travel job in Red Lodge, Montana, should inquire about comprehensive health insurance, housing stipends, and assistance with licensing costs. Additionally, it’s beneficial to ask for flexible scheduling options and opportunities for continued education to enhance professional development.

Bozeman, Montana, is a city that shares several similarities with Red Lodge, particularly for Acute Care Physical Therapists seeking a similar working environment and lifestyle. With a median pay range for physical therapists typically between $75,000 and $90,000, Bozeman offers competitive salaries that align well with Red Lodge. The cost of living is relatively moderate, although it has risen in recent years due to the city’s growing popularity and outdoor tourism. Known for its access to both culture and nature, Bozeman provides a vibrant community atmosphere with recreational activities including hiking, skiing, and access to nearby Yellowstone National Park, making it ideal for outdoor enthusiasts.
